Alhaji Lai Mohammed, minister of information and culture has extolled the administration of President Muhammadu Buhari.

PM News reports that the minister who spoke on the topic, “The Change Agenda: The Journey so far,” at the annual general meeting of the alumni Association of the National Institute (AANI) in Kuru, close to Jos, said President Buhari government has availed itself creditably in the implementation of its “Change Agenda.”

Lai Mohammed says the present administration has achieved a lot in the fight against corruption and insurgency.

“As far as our Change Agenda is concerned, the journey so far has been good, and it will definitely get better as we progress.

‎“We have faced and tackled, with sincerity and courage, both anticipated and unanticipated challenges. Our major security nightmare, Boko Haram, is fast giving way to a sweet dream, while we have not shied away from taking on other security challenges. We are winning the war against corruption, even as corruption fights back fast and furious. We are committed to diversifying our economy away from oil, while plugging all financial leakages. Our President is working night and day to make our country a respected member of the comity of nations, once again,” he said.

Mohammed stated that the All Progressives Congress (APC) campaigned on major issues like curbing insecurity, particularly the Boko Haram insurgency in the North-East, fight corruption and revamp the country’s economy, which includes jobs creation, diversification of the economy from oil, etc. He said the administration had made huge progress in all the aforementioned areas
